    • @sirwooley
      @sirwooley 10 місяців тому +16

      Correct, but that's because you're not the customer. If you're watching this video, you're not the person that they are marketing to. There's a funny psychological thing going on. No one likes being sold to, but everybody loves to buy things. When they market their product like this they are completely bypassing the sales resistance of the customer because the buyer is really getting the product "for free". After their guard is down selling something to someone gets much, much easier. Does it fool everyone? Not at all. But it's surprisingly effective.
      One of my first jobs I ever worked was at an amusement park, in a carnival style game called Basket Toss. You would tahrow a softball into a basket and win a prize if it stayed in. You could buy 3 balls for $5, or you could buy 7 balls for $10. While guests would want to play, they always bought the 3 balls for $5 despite the 7 for 10 being the better deal. Of course, just like any carnie game it's designed to look easy but it's much more complex and requires a specific strategy to win. After they lost, I would call them close and say "hey, I'm not really supposed to do this but, I'll give you 4 balls for $5 if you wanna try one more time." It worked all the time, because people loved feeling like they were getting a really good deal. Only 1 in maybe 100 would say, "that's just the same deal as the 7 for $10". They were caught up in the joy of risk, the feeling like they were getting cut in on a bargain, and their eyes on the huge prizes they could win that were SURELY worth the extra $5 they would spend. Here's the kicker, though. Even if they won (they were relatively large prizes), the prizes they won cost the company about .83 cents on average. The house always wins, as they say. I can almost guarantee that even at the $10 for "shipping and handling" on the book, they are making a profit.

  • @algheroman6476
    @algheroman6476 4 місяці тому +1

    So you compare selling 1,000 books a $5 to 1,000 books at $9.95 as the base (6:32 mark of video). Not really the same thing, is it? Plus selling 1,000 books on Amazon KDP is not a trivial task.

    • @fabiennehansen
      @fabiennehansen  4 місяці тому +1

      You're right. It's harder to sell 1,000 books on Amazon. But you can if you run ads. The challenge is that you get ~$5 in revenue, and no email addresses to build a relationship with your customer. That's why you use this funnel instead and run ads to it, because your return will be higher, because of the upsells along the way. This is why the funnel is being used so much, because you will get more back from your ad investment.
